Will a D-17 rearend fit in a WD-45? and will it slow the ratio down? Has anyone tried this? Someone tried to tell me it would work. I'm looking to slow my 45 down a little.

I've been told it will work and is the same ratio as a wd45 deisel rear end. Thais is only the rear ring and pinion, like a cars rear end not the trans gears.
